In a very cascade airlock, force differentials are crucial to protecting correct airflow path. Air naturally flows from superior-force spots to very low-stress types, Therefore the airlock is intended to maintain the next pressure from the cleaner space, a medium stress Within the airlock, and also a decrease force in the adjacent significantly less clear place.

In the bubble airlock, the air force throughout the airlock is ready higher than in the two adjoining parts. Any time a doorway is opened to possibly a cleaner or much less thoroughly clean Area, the higher pressure inside the airlock makes certain that air flows outward, blocking the motion of particles, contaminants, or airborne microorganisms into the more managed ecosystem.
